Transaction 21223fa686a5c5c867bdfa9321740603b8d7dc869438fc4c26dc7504a070ea72
1 Input
1 Output
-
21223fa686a5c5c867bdfa9321740603b8d7dc869438fc4c26dc7504a070ea72:0
- value
- 590000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4246e103c47529726f7f98407c22535a676b22f3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 173SWRDd1qu6H9VX51r8JZmZfFn91ic2d5